Frequently Asked Questions about Silver Spring
How much are Studio apartments in Silver Spring?
There are currently 443 Studio Apartments in Silver Spring with rent ranges from $744 to $2,849 with an average price of $1,630.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Silver Spring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Silver Spring ranges from $1,046 to $4,369 with an average monthly rent of $1,907.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Silver Spring c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Silver Spring range from $950 to $5,311.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,256.
How expensive are Silver Spring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 153 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Silver Spring on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$712 to $6,277 - averaging $2,637 for the location.
